Money View, India’s leading money management app and 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und, a leading Mutual Fund (MF), announce the launch of an innovative and first-of-its-kind app-based solution to allow users to save & grow their money smartly. In partnership with 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und, Money View through its Green Account platform will offer two exclusive products Savings+ and Tax Saver+. These products facilitate users to take a step ahead towards financial fitness by saving money and endeavor to grow it faster.

Savings+ is designed to get users in the habit of saving money regularly for their short and medium term goals – like buying a car, taking a family vacation, creating an emergency fund, etc. The product serves as a suitable alternative to traditional saving options. These savings could grow by allowing users to park them in Liquid Funds offered by 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und. Furthermore, such schemes usually have no exit load or withdrawal penalty, which gives users the flexibility to withdraw the funds whenever they need.

Tax Saver+, the second product offered through this partnership, helps users save on their tax by investing in Equity Linked Savings Scheme (ELSS) option provided by 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und. Users can save up to Rs. 46,350 in taxes depending on their tax rate by investing up to Rs. 1.5 lac annually.MoneyView 47755
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und and Money View have integrated their systems to make this offering completely digital. To take advantage of these products, the user can create a new account by completing a quick and easy paperless application form within the Money View app and start investing through Savings+ and Tax Saver+. The user can not only invest from the app but also manage their portfolio, invest more or withdraw funds (subject to applicability of lock-in period for ELSS) anywhere anytime with just a few taps on the Money View app.
